Program Description

https://www.purdue.edu/science/Current_Students/study-abroad/genetics_uk.html

This study abroad program is designed to explore the intersection of genetics, culture, ethics, and public policy in a global context. London and Scotland offer uniquely rich educational environments for this program due to their historical and contemporary contributions to genetics and biology research.
